Cloning and Expression of the Gene Encoding the 32-kDa Protein of Rickettsia typhi
Journal of the Korean Society for Microbiology ; : 399-404, 1997.
Article in Korean | WPRIM | ID: wpr-81357
ABSTRACT
The crystalline surface layer protein (SLP) and a 28-32 kDa antigen of Rickettsia typhi were known as strong immunogens. We previously reported a cloning and sequence analysis of the SLP gene of R. typhi (slpT) and showed that the open reading frame of this gene encodes both the SLP and a 32-kDa protein. Our study also showed that a 48-kDa protein reacted strongly with polyclonal antiserum of a patient with murine typhus. In this study, we produced three recombinant proteins (SLP, 32-kDa, and 48-kDa protein) in E. coli as fusion proteins with maltose binding proteins. The reactivity of these proteins with patients' sera was investigated.
